> To my understanding Adrian just fixed a potential oops.
> You have a driver that surely are thought to be hotplugable -
> otherwise qpti_sbus_probe() would not have been annotated __devinit.
> And had it ever been hotplugged then you had called a function in
> a __init section that was long gone.
>...

s/had it ever been hotplugged/had it been hotplugged with a kernel
                              compiled with gcc 3.2 or 3.3/
